A decoder including first and second decoding stages for selecting a codeword near to a given N-tuple r which is a sequence of N real values r.sub.i representing signals. The first stage includes substages associated respectively with sections r.sub.j of N-tuple r, each substage for evaluating distances...http://www.google.es/patents/US4933956?utm_source=gb-gplus-sharePatente US4933956 - Simplified decoding of lattices and codes